Пожалуйста, войдите здесь. Часто задаваемые вопросы О нас
Задайте Ваш вопрос

Настройка cli aliases

0

Хочу ускорить открытие некоторых файлов или листинга из CLI Астериска. Есть ли возможность настройки сокращений для команд Linux из cli_aliases.conf? Команды через восклицательный знак не работают.

Второй вариант. Создала алиасы в самом Линуксе. Из Linux CLI работают, из Астериска - нет, только полностью писать команду.

удалить закрыть спам изменить тег редактировать

спросил 2017-03-06 19:33:54 +0400

bestann Gravatar bestann
1 8 1 2

обновил 2017-03-06 19:37:22 +0400

Comments

Ну да, в файле cli_aliases.conf получается только алиасы на команды Астериска создать. Я думала типа alias=!vim .... Спасибо за подсказку про bash файлы. Работает.

bestann ( 2017-03-06 21:11:50 +0400 )редактировать

1 Ответ

0

ничего не понял. для астерисковых команд работает астерисковые алиасы. Почему они должны работать черз восклицательный знак? восклицательный знак это System call.

Алиасы у вас башовские(шела)

Хотите в астериске запускать алиасы шела - запускайте предварительно шел или сделайти не алиасы, а bash-файлы в /usr/bin/

pro-sip*CLI> !ts
kakayato erunda
pro-sip*CLI> 
Disconnected from Asterisk server
Asterisk cleanly ending (0).
Executing last minute cleanups
[root@pro-sip ~]# cat /bin/ts
#!/bin/bash
echo "kakayato erunda"
[root@pro-sip ~]#
ссылка удалить спам редактировать

ответил 2017-03-06 21:04:02 +0400

meral Gravatar meral flag of Ukraine
22007 24 20 172
http://pro-sip.net/

обновил 2017-03-06 21:05:33 +0400

Ваш ответ

Please start posting your answer anonymously - your answer will be saved within the current session and published after you log in or create a new account. Please try to give a substantial answer, for discussions, please use comments and please do remember to vote (after you log in)!
[скрыть предварительный просмотр]

Закладки и информация

Добавить закладку

подписаться на rss ленту новостей

Статистика

Задан: 2017-03-06 19:33:54 +0400

Просмотрен: 109 раз

Обновлен: Mar 06

Похожие вопросы:

Проект компании "АТС Дизайн"
Asterisk® и Digium® являются зарегистрированными торговыми марками компании Digium, Inc., США.
IP АТС Asterisk распространяется под лицензией GNU GPL.